What Should I Consider When Selecting a Coach?
To pick the right coach, one should examine their individual goals, research prospective coaches' credentials and specialties, seek recommendations, and arrange introductory consultations to determine compatibility and communication styles before making a decision.
What Is the Expected Duration of a Coaching Program?
Most coaching programs run for approximately three to six months. Depending on personal targets, challenge complexity, and coaching techniques, some programs stretch to twelve months.
Are Coaching Sessions Offered In-Person or Virtually?
Coaching appointments may be arranged through in-person or virtual means, depending on the choices of the client and coach. Both formats provide specific benefits, enabling versatile scheduling and reach for individuals seeking support.
What Do Professional Coaching Services Typically Cost?
Professional coaching typically costs from $50 to $500 per session, determined by the coach's expertise, specialty area, and geographic location. Package deals may also be provided, which can reduce the overall cost for multiple sessions or comprehensive programs.
